## Break-glass access: TaxTrellis rate cache

If the tax-rate lookup cache in TaxTrellis goes stale during a review and you can't wait for the normal refresh, break-glass is allowed. It flushes the cache and pulls fresh rates from the Quillbrook source-of-truth. Use it sparingly — it's logged and someone will ask why. The break-glass console unlocks with a recovery passphrase, listed just below for reviewers.

recovery phrase for bawep-kawef: oliath-casdor

**Mgmt Meeting Minutes — Retiring the Brightline Range**

Quick recap for sales leads at Fenholt Supplies: we agreed to retire the Brightline fixture range by year-end. Remaining stock moves to clearance pricing next month, and accounts on standing orders get migrated to the Lumetta range. Trade-in incentives were approved in principle. The confidential note on next steps sits just below.

board note of bajof-bajeg: The pricing group signed off on a budget of $13.4 million for Project Sildor. The renewal with Lamixek Holdings closes at $48.9 million a year, 49 percent above the last contract.

## Changelog — WardenKiosk 2.8

Changed defaults, flagging for weekly sync. Watchdog restart backoff dropped from 30s to 10s after the Fennmark pilot showed hung shells recovering too slowly. Heartbeat interval tightened; missed-beat threshold now 3, not 5. Crash dumps rotate at 50MB instead of unbounded. No behavior change for units pinned to 2.7 profiles. Rollout is fleet-wide Thursday. The watchdog ships with the following default configuration values.

settings of bawif-fawif:
ralix:
  log_level: warn
  metrics_host: metrics.ralix.tolvaqsys.internal
  pool_size: 32

# Cold Storage Archival — notes for the weekly eng sync (Team Permafrost)
# This config governs the nightly sweep that moves buckets untouched for 180+
# days from the Tarnwell hot tier into Glacierpoint cold storage. Please review
# ARCHIVE_BATCH_SIZE carefully before changing it; batches over 500 objects
# have caused manifest timeouts twice this quarter. Restores must go through
# the ops queue, never directly. The sweep job authenticates to the
# Glacierpoint API with the key declared on the next line.

secret setting of kagug-tajep: COURIER_KEY8=e81a8675